S&P Global is seeking a Survey Research Analyst to support execution of primary market research projects with an emphasis on survey operations, data quality, and production of research deliverables. This individual contributor role partners with sales, project managers, internal SMEs, and external vendors to design, field, validate, and present high-quality survey-based research.
Key Responsibilities
- Execute end-to-end survey projects: questionnaire design, programming, fielding, data validation, and deliverable production
- Support both custom research and syndicated programs
- Serve as a client-facing research partner on methodology, survey design, and progress calls
- Manage sample providers and external vendors to meet timelines, sampling plans, and quality standards
- Monitor fieldwork at key milestones (soft launch, midpoint, final) and recommend adjustments
- Produce and quality-check crosstabs and structured survey outputs
- Create PowerPoint decks, charts, and other presentation materials for clients
